Christopher Jullien is a French central defender currently with Montpellier Hérault SC in Ligue 1, known for his commanding aerial ability and physical strength at 195cm. Jullien's career has seen him rise to prominence with a successful stint at Celtic FC in Scotland. After starting in France with Auxerre and Toulouse, his move to Celtic in 2019 was a major breakthrough. He became a fan favorite, scoring crucial goals and forming a formidable defensive partnership, winning multiple Scottish Premiership titles, Scottish Cups, and Scottish League Cups. His time in Glasgow was highlighted by his last-minute winner in the 2019 Scottish League Cup final. A serious knee injury in 2020 disrupted his momentum, but he has fought back to resume his career in France. Jullien is a dominant center-back, exceptional in the air from set-pieces and a brave shot-blocker. Now back in Ligue 1, he is looking to re-establish himself as one of the league's top defenders.
